POLSC 14: International Relations                                            3 units
Lecture: 3 hours
Introduction to the principles and practices of international politics, emphasizing problems of war and peace, foreign policies of major powers, problems of developing countries, and global problems.  Emphasis placed upon the formulation and execution of American framework.  The dynamics of interstate relations, diplomacy, international law, non- state actors and supra-national organizations will be emphasized.  MJC POLSC 110)
Transfer:  UC/CSU
